在工业自动化领域,可编程逻辑控制器(PLC)和博途(TIA Portal)是两个不可或缺的工具。PLC作为工业自动化的核心,负责控制各种机械和过程;而博途则是西门子提供的集成平台,用于编程、调试和监控PLC。本文将带您轻松入门PLC编程与博途的使用,并提供实用的技巧解析。
一、PLC基础知识
1. PLC的定义与组成
PLC,即可编程逻辑控制器,是一种用于工业控制的数字运算操作电子系统。它主要由以下几部分组成:
- 中央处理单元(CPU):负责执行程序,处理输入和输出信号。
- 输入模块(I/O):接收外部设备(如传感器、按钮等)的信号。
- 输出模块(I/O):将CPU的处理结果输出到外部设备(如电机、继电器等)。
- 存储器:用于存储程序和数据处理。
- 电源:为PLC提供电力。
2. PLC的工作原理
PLC通过扫描输入信号,执行程序,然后输出信号,从而控制外部设备。其工作流程如下:
- 输入扫描:PLC从输入模块读取信号。
- 程序执行:CPU根据程序逻辑处理输入信号。
- 输出刷新:CPU将处理结果输出到输出模块。
二、博途(TIA Portal)简介
博途是西门子推出的一款集成平台,用于编程、调试和监控PLC。它具有以下特点:
- 图形化编程:使用梯形图、功能块图等图形化编程语言,易于理解和学习。
- 集成化:将编程、调试、监控等功能集成在一个平台上,提高工作效率。
- 兼容性强:支持多种PLC型号和编程语言。
三、PLC编程技巧
1. 熟练掌握编程语言
博途支持多种编程语言,如梯形图、功能块图、结构化文本等。熟练掌握这些编程语言是进行PLC编程的基础。
2. 合理规划程序结构
在编写程序时,应遵循模块化、层次化的原则,将程序划分为多个功能模块,便于维护和调试。
3. 利用库函数和标准块
博途提供了丰富的库函数和标准块,可以简化编程过程。在实际编程中,应充分利用这些资源。
4. 注意程序优化
在编写程序时,应注意程序优化,提高程序执行效率。例如,合理使用循环、条件判断等语句。
四、博途使用技巧
1. 创建项目
在博途中,首先需要创建一个项目,用于组织和管理程序、配置文件等。
2. 编写程序
在项目中创建程序,并使用梯形图、功能块图等编程语言进行编程。
3. 调试程序
在程序编写完成后,需要进行调试,确保程序正常运行。
4. 监控程序
通过博途的监控功能,可以实时查看PLC的运行状态,及时发现并解决问题。
五、总结
PLC编程与博途是工业自动化领域的重要工具。通过本文的介绍,相信您已经对PLC编程与博途有了初步的了解。在实际应用中,不断积累经验,掌握更多编程技巧,将有助于提高工作效率,为工业自动化领域的发展贡献力量。
